Four-vehicle crash in Ishpeming

ISHPEMING, MI--   Three people are injured, following a four-vehicle accident in Ishpeming. 

City Police say the crash happened Wednesday at 4:46 p.m. at the intersection of US-41 and Lakeshore Drive.  A 61-year-old Ishpeming man was northbound on Lakeshore in a Mazda sedan when a Buick LeSabre  

westbound on 41 ran a red light and hit the Mazda.  The Buick was driven by a 24-year-old South Range woman. 

The force of the impact drove the Buick into an Impala stopped at the intersection.  The Impala was then forced backward into a Dodge Avenger.  Three of the four vehicles had to be towed from the scene. 

Three people were taken to Bell Hospital for treatment of their injuries.  Their conditions are unknown at this time.
